Web development in Python courses can help you learn web frameworks like Django and Flask, RESTful API design, and database integration. You can build skills in front-end technologies such as HTML, CSS, and JavaScript, along with back-end development practices to create dynamic web applications. Many courses introduce tools like Git for version control, PostgreSQL for database management, and testing frameworks to ensure code quality, connecting these skills to real-world projects and collaborative development environments.

Vanderbilt University
Skills you'll gain: Git (Version Control System), JUnit, Android Studio, Android Development, Unit Testing, Maintainability, Software Design Patterns, Test Automation, File I/O, Object Oriented Programming (OOP), Integration Testing, Test Driven Development (TDD), Mobile Development, Software Testing, Testability, Software Engineering, Java Programming, Java, Application Security, Development Testing
Beginner · Specialization · 3 - 6 Months

Coursera
Skills you'll gain: Ajax, JSON, JavaScript Frameworks, Javascript, Application Programming Interface (API), Web Applications, Application Security
Intermediate · Course · 1 - 4 Weeks

Duke University
Skills you'll gain: Package and Software Management, Virtual Environment, Development Environment, Software Installation, Configuration Management, Python Programming, Command-Line Interface
Beginner · Guided Project · Less Than 2 Hours

Yonsei University
Skills you'll gain: Sustainable Development, Environmental Issue, Community Development, Socioeconomics, Environmental Policy, Sustainability Standards, Economics, Policy, and Social Studies, International Relations, Social Justice, Strategic Partnership, Climate Change Adaptation, Climate Change Mitigation, Empowerment, Governance, Innovation
Beginner · Course · 1 - 3 Months

Infosec
Skills you'll gain: Network Analysis, Network Security, Intrusion Detection and Prevention, Cybersecurity, Threat Detection, Network Monitoring, Anomaly Detection
Mixed · Course · 1 - 4 Weeks

Macquarie University
Skills you'll gain: Stress Management, Resilience, Personal Development, Time Management, Intercultural Competence, Cultural Diversity, Productivity, Cultural Sensitivity, Adaptability, Self-Awareness, Business Ethics, Leadership Development, Business Communication, Cognitive flexibility, Diversity Awareness, Professional Development, Diversity and Inclusion, Workplace inclusivity, Lifelong Learning, Communication
Beginner · Specialization · 3 - 6 Months

Logical Operations
Skills you'll gain: Hypertext Markup Language (HTML), HTML and CSS, Cascading Style Sheets (CSS), Web Content, Web Design and Development, Web Design, Web Development, Typography, Web Applications, Front-End Web Development, Web Servers, Embeddings, Web Development Tools, Software Development
Mixed · Course · 1 - 4 Weeks

Skills you'll gain: HTML and CSS, Responsive Web Design, Bootstrap (Front-End Framework), Web Design, Web Design and Development, Cascading Style Sheets (CSS), Web Applications, User Interface (UI), Front-End Web Development, User Interface (UI) Design, UI Components, Web Development Tools
Beginner · Specialization · 1 - 3 Months

Duke University
Skills you'll gain: Debugging, Algorithms, Problem Solving, Data Processing, Python Programming, Software Development, Data Analysis
Beginner · Course · 1 - 4 Weeks

Rice University
Skills you'll gain: Data Manipulation, File I/O, Data Structures, Scripting, Data Import/Export, Data Analysis, Python Programming, Data Storage
Beginner · Course · 1 - 4 Weeks
University of Michigan
Skills you'll gain: Database Design, Relational Databases, SQL, Databases, Data Visualization Software, Web Scraping, Data Modeling, Object Oriented Programming (OOP), Data Processing, Geographic Information Systems, Python Programming, Application Programming Interface (API)
Beginner · Course · 1 - 3 Months

O.P. Jindal Global University
Skills you'll gain: Economic Development, Sustainable Development, Socioeconomics, Economics, Human Development, International Relations, Growth Strategies, Sociology, Demography, Policy Analysis
Build toward a degree
Beginner · Course · 1 - 3 Months